Output 3fa5cbfc2c59b4cfde2bbf4e0f8226ad31bb434d91b0fab2e8eb56edd9af7609:1

value
2713968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a0b75a74b73b48818a3039076c7b72dd0e5af96 OP_EQUAL
address
3QV8aj8bKrTFjqMHtDnEMzSChT3L9iehcT
transaction
3fa5cbfc2c59b4cfde2bbf4e0f8226ad31bb434d91b0fab2e8eb56edd9af7609
confirmations
91688
spent
true